Navigating the Competitive Landscape: Artisan Bakery Market Analysis
The competitive landscape of the Artisan Bakery Market is a fascinating study in contrast, pitting small, independent producers against larger food Industry players. A deep Analysis reveals that authenticity and perceived quality are the primary competitive advantages for artisan businesses. While scale and pricing power belong to large-scale manufacturers, artisan bakeries win on the factors that truly matter to the discerning consumer: taste, ingredient integrity, and unique craftsmanship.
The market is characterized by a high degree of fragmentation, yet this is also where its strength lies. The collective appeal of numerous local businesses contributes significantly to the overall market Size and resilience. These small operations often become local hubs, fostering community loyalty that large chains find difficult to replicate. This strong local footing is a key factor in securing their market Share.
One of the significant Trends observed is the co-existence of artisan and mass-market products in the same retail environments. Supermarkets and large retailers are increasingly dedicating premium shelf space to genuine artisan goods, either by sourcing from local producers or by developing their own 'artisan-style' lines. This shift confirms the undeniable consumer demand for the artisanal experience, further validating the market's strong Growth trajectory.
To maintain their competitive edge, artisan bakeries must focus on differentiation. This includes investing in unique flavor profiles, using rare or high-quality flours, and upholding the traditional, slow-baking processes that enhance flavor complexity. Regular Analysis of consumer preferences for new ingredients and health-focused options is vital for staying ahead of the curve. The ability to quickly introduce seasonal or limited-edition products is another key competitive strategy that capitalizes on market Trends.
Challenges, such as higher production costs and labor intensity, necessitate smart business management. Optimizing kitchen processes, managing ingredient procurement, and strategically pricing products are crucial for profitability. Despite these hurdles, the Forecast remains optimistic. The enduring value consumers place on handcrafted, premium food experiences ensures that the Artisan Bakery Market will continue to expand its Size and maintain a significant Share within the food Industry. The core of success lies in upholding the promise of superior quality.

How can artisan bakeries manage higher production costs? They manage costs by optimizing ingredient sourcing, implementing efficient production schedules, and justifying higher prices through premium quality and unique product offerings, as shown in Analysis.
-
What are the primary distribution channels for artisan products? Primary channels include direct-to-consumer sales from the bakery, specialized food stores, cafes, and increasingly, online platforms and strategic partnerships with high-end retailers.
